Output c032513208e9254ec884cbb2e8edb3d1fe07f369c5aa23c3b2ed5630bd6d9c12:19

value
538363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b195e42464e32b995f12b4abdb468854a6cc13c OP_EQUAL
address
375WBUWVLWKd7og3eABZbEDGBmvgftpUDv
transaction
c032513208e9254ec884cbb2e8edb3d1fe07f369c5aa23c3b2ed5630bd6d9c12
spent
true